Man involved in 2019 death of Robenson Saint Jean pleads guilty to manslaughter

Jeffrey Miller was originally charged with second-degree murder but pleaded guilty to the lesser charge of manslaughter for facilitating a meeting between Robenson Saint Jean and another drug dealer that turned violent, resulting in Saint Jean’s death on March 29, 2019.

Peter Keeash guilty of second-degree murder for 2018 death of Irene Barkman

Justice Danial Newton found the evidence proved beyond a reasonable doubt that Peter Keeash stabbed Irene Barkman in the neck the night of Oct. 29, 2018, resulting in her death two days later.

Judge dismisses dangerous offender assessment of Jonathan Yellowhead

The dangerous offender assessment was sought by the Crown following Yellowhead pleading guilty to aggravated assault for an attack on another inmate at the Thunder Bay District Jail
